   10-7-50.    Compelling contribution -- After paying more than equal share; effect of surety's insolvency 
      Where  several are sureties for the same principal for the same sum of money,  either by one or by distinct instruments, and one pays more than an  equal share of the sum, he may compel contribution from his cosureties.  If one of the cosureties is insolvent, the deficiency in his share must  be borne equally by the solvent sureties.
